MagicDTree:基于jQuery的树形控件探索

MagicDTree,jQuery插件,Dynatree,右键菜单,节点操作

在当今数字化时代,数据可视化的重要性不言而喻。MagicDTree作为一款基于jQuery的树形控件,不仅继承了Dynatree插件的所有强大功能,更在此基础上进行了创新性的扩展。这款插件不仅提升了用户的交互体验,还极大地简化了开发者的工作流程。MagicDTree的设计初衷是为了让开发者能够更加轻松地创建出美观且功能强大的树形结构界面。

MagicDTree的一大亮点在于它新增的右键菜单功能。用户可以通过简单的鼠标操作实现对节点的添加、删除和更新等操作,极大地提高了工作效率。此外,MagicDTree还支持自定义样式,使得开发者可以根据实际需求调整控件的外观,使其更好地融入到现有的项目设计中。

Dynatree是一款广受好评的jQuery插件,它最初由ChristianBach设计并开发。该插件以其高度可定制性和灵活性而闻名,被广泛应用于各种Web应用程序中。Dynatree支持多种数据源,包括JSON、XML和AJAX请求,这使得它能够轻松处理复杂的数据结构。

MagicDTree在继承Dynatree核心功能的基础上,进一步增强了其实用性。例如,通过集成右键菜单功能,用户可以更加直观地管理树形结构中的各个节点。此外,MagicDTree还提供了详细的文档和丰富的代码示例,帮助开发者快速上手并充分利用其所有功能。

无论是对于前端开发者还是后端工程师来说,MagicDTree都是一个值得尝试的强大工具。它不仅简化了树形结构的创建过程,还为用户提供了一个更加友好和高效的交互环境。

MagicDTree不仅仅是一款树形控件,它更是前端开发领域的一次革新。这款插件的核心优势在于其强大的功能集合与卓越的用户体验设计。首先,MagicDTree的右键菜单功能极大地提升了用户的操作便捷性。用户只需简单地点击右键,即可轻松实现节点的添加、删除和更新操作。这一设计不仅简化了用户的操作步骤,也使得数据管理变得更加高效和直观。

此外,MagicDTree还支持自定义样式,这意味着开发者可以根据项目的具体需求调整控件的外观。无论是颜色、字体还是布局,都可以根据实际应用场景进行个性化设置。这种高度的灵活性使得MagicDTree成为了众多开发者眼中的“瑞士军刀”,几乎适用于任何类型的Web应用程序。

更重要的是,MagicDTree提供了详尽的文档和丰富的代码示例。这些资源不仅帮助开发者快速上手,还能让他们深入理解每一个功能背后的实现原理。无论是初学者还是经验丰富的开发者,都能从中受益匪浅。通过这些示例,开发者可以迅速构建出功能完善的树形结构界面,大大缩短了开发周期。

Dynatree插件自问世以来,便以其高度可定制性和灵活性赢得了广大开发者的青睐。这款插件最初由ChristianBach设计并开发,其核心优势在于支持多种数据源,包括JSON、XML和AJAX请求。这意味着无论数据多么复杂,Dynatree都能轻松应对,确保数据的准确展示。

Dynatree的另一个显著特点是其强大的扩展性。开发者可以根据实际需求添加各种自定义功能,如拖拽、排序和筛选等。这些功能不仅丰富了树形结构的表现形式,也为用户提供了更多的交互方式。通过这些扩展功能,开发者可以轻松打造出符合特定业务场景的应用程序。

此外,Dynatree的文档非常详尽,涵盖了从基础安装到高级配置的各个方面。这些文档不仅帮助开发者快速入门,还提供了大量的实用技巧和最佳实践。无论是新手还是专家,都能从中找到所需的信息,从而更好地利用Dynatree的强大功能。

在实际开发过程中,MagicDTree展现出了其广泛的应用潜力。无论是企业级应用还是个人项目,MagicDTree都能提供卓越的解决方案。以下是一些典型的应用场景:

在企业资源管理系统中,数据的组织和管理至关重要。MagicDTree的右键菜单功能使得用户可以方便地添加、删除和更新节点,极大地简化了数据维护工作。例如,在一个大型企业的部门结构中,每个部门可能包含多个子部门和员工信息。通过MagicDTree,管理员可以轻松地调整部门结构,无需复杂的操作流程。

文件管理系统是另一个非常适合使用MagicDTree的场景。用户可以通过右键菜单快速创建文件夹、重命名文件或删除不必要的文件。这种直观的操作方式不仅提高了用户的效率,还增强了系统的易用性。特别是在云存储服务中,MagicDTree的自定义样式功能可以让系统界面更加美观,提升用户体验。

在项目管理平台中,任务和子任务的组织通常采用树形结构。MagicDTree的强大功能可以帮助项目经理更好地分配任务,跟踪进度。例如,在一个软件开发项目中,不同的模块和功能可以按照层级关系进行划分。通过MagicDTree,团队成员可以清晰地看到自己的任务,并随时更新状态,提高协作效率。

教育培训机构经常需要管理大量的课程和学习资源。MagicDTree的右键菜单功能使得教师可以方便地添加新的课程模块,更新课程内容。学生也可以通过简单的操作查找和访问所需的资料。这种灵活的管理方式不仅提升了教学效果,还增强了学生的参与度。

Dynatree插件因其高度可定制性和灵活性,在多种场景下都有着出色的表现。以下是几个典型的应用案例:

数据分析平台通常需要处理大量复杂的数据结构。Dynatree支持多种数据源,包括JSON、XML和AJAX请求,这使得它能够轻松应对各种数据格式。例如,在一个金融分析系统中,Dynatree可以用来展示公司的组织架构、财务报表和市场分析结果。通过Dynatree的强大扩展性,开发者可以添加各种自定义功能,如数据筛选和排序,使用户能够更直观地理解数据。

在电子商务网站中,商品分类和品牌展示通常采用树形结构。Dynatree的高度可定制性使得开发者可以根据实际需求调整控件的外观和功能。例如,在一个在线购物平台中,Dynatree可以用来展示不同类别的商品,并支持用户通过拖拽等方式重新排列商品顺序。这种灵活的设计不仅提升了用户的购物体验,还增强了网站的互动性。

无论是企业级应用还是个人项目,Dynatree插件都能提供强大的支持,帮助开发者构建出功能完善且易于使用的树形结构界面。

在现代Web开发中,用户体验的优化至关重要。MagicDTree的右键菜单功能正是为此而生,它不仅提升了用户的操作便捷性,还极大地简化了数据管理的过程。当用户在树形结构中选中某个节点时,只需轻轻一点右键,即可弹出一个简洁明了的菜单,其中包含了添加、删除和更新节点等一系列常用操作选项。

这一设计不仅让用户感到操作更为直观,还大幅提升了工作效率。例如,在企业资源管理系统中,管理员需要频繁地调整部门结构或更新员工信息。传统的操作方式往往繁琐且耗时,而MagicDTree的右键菜单则让这一切变得轻而易举。用户可以在几秒钟内完成节点的添加或删除,无需再经历复杂的多步操作。

此外,MagicDTree的右键菜单还支持自定义功能。开发者可以根据实际需求添加更多选项,如批量操作、导出数据等。这种高度的灵活性使得MagicDTree成为了众多企业级应用的理想选择。无论是文件管理系统中的文件夹管理,还是项目管理平台中的任务分配,MagicDTree的右键菜单都能提供高效且直观的操作体验。

虽然Dynatree插件本身已经具备了强大的功能,但其右键菜单功能同样不容小觑。Dynatree的右键菜单同样支持添加、删除和更新节点等基本操作,同时还提供了丰富的自定义选项。开发者可以根据具体应用场景添加更多功能,如拖拽、排序和筛选等。

Dynatree的右键菜单在数据分析平台中的应用尤为突出。在处理大量复杂数据时,用户可以通过右键菜单快速筛选和排序数据,使得数据展示更加直观。例如,在一个金融分析系统中,用户可以轻松地查看公司的组织架构、财务报表和市场分析结果。通过Dynatree的右键菜单,用户还可以进行数据筛选和排序,使数据呈现更加清晰。

无论是企业级应用还是个人项目,Dynatree插件的右键菜单功能都能为用户提供更加友好和高效的交互环境。通过这些功能,开发者可以轻松打造出功能完善且易于使用的树形结构界面,极大地提升了用户的满意度和工作效率。

在MagicDTree中,节点操作功能是其最引人注目的特色之一。无论是添加新节点、删除现有节点还是更新节点信息,这些操作都被设计得极其直观和高效。用户只需简单的鼠标点击,即可完成一系列复杂的任务,极大地提升了用户体验。

添加节点:在MagicDTree中,添加新节点变得异常简单。用户只需右键点击目标位置,选择“添加节点”选项,即可在指定位置创建一个新的节点。这一功能不仅适用于单个节点的添加,还支持批量操作,使得数据管理变得更加高效。例如,在企业资源管理系统中,管理员可以快速添加新的部门或员工信息,无需繁琐的多步操作。

删除节点:删除节点同样简便。用户只需右键点击目标节点,选择“删除节点”选项,即可轻松移除不需要的节点。这一功能在文件管理系统中尤为重要。用户可以快速删除不再需要的文件或文件夹,保持系统的整洁有序。特别是在云存储服务中,MagicDTree的自定义样式功能使得界面更加美观,提升了用户体验。

MagicDTree的节点操作功能不仅提升了用户的操作便捷性,还极大地简化了数据管理的过程。无论是企业级应用还是个人项目,MagicDTree都能提供卓越的解决方案,帮助用户更加高效地管理和组织数据。

尽管Dynatree插件本身已经具备了强大的功能,但在节点操作方面同样表现优异。Dynatree的节点操作功能不仅支持基本的添加、删除和更新操作,还提供了丰富的自定义选项,使得开发者可以根据具体应用场景添加更多功能。

添加节点:在Dynatree中,添加新节点同样简单直观。用户只需右键点击目标位置,选择“添加节点”选项,即可在指定位置创建一个新的节点。这一功能在数据分析平台中尤为重要。用户可以轻松地添加新的数据节点,使得数据展示更加全面。例如,在一个金融分析系统中,用户可以轻松地查看公司的组织架构、财务报表和市场分析结果。通过Dynatree的节点操作功能,用户可以更加直观地理解数据。

无论是企业级应用还是个人项目,Dynatree插件的节点操作功能都能为用户提供更加友好和高效的交互环境。通过这些功能,开发者可以轻松打造出功能完善且易于使用的树形结构界面,极大地提升了用户的满意度和工作效率。

综上所述,MagicDTree作为一款基于jQuery的树形控件,不仅继承了Dynatree插件的强大功能,还在用户体验和实用性方面进行了显著改进。其新增的右键菜单功能极大地提升了用户的操作便捷性,使得节点的添加、删除和更新变得更加直观和高效。无论是企业资源管理系统、文件管理系统,还是项目管理平台和教育培训平台,MagicDTree都能提供卓越的解决方案,帮助用户更加高效地管理和组织数据。

与此同时,Dynatree插件凭借其高度可定制性和灵活性,在多种应用场景中同样表现出色。无论是数据分析平台、社交媒体应用,还是电子商务网站,Dynatree都能轻松应对复杂的数据结构,并提供丰富的自定义功能,满足不同业务场景的需求。

总之,无论是MagicDTree还是Dynatree插件,它们都是前端开发领域的强大工具,能够帮助开发者构建出美观且功能完善的树形结构界面,极大地提升了用户的满意度和工作效率。

7*24小时服务

保证您的售后无忧

1v1专属服务

保证服务质量

担保交易

全程担保交易保证资金安全

服务全程监管

全周期保证商品服务质量

2015-2023WWW.SHOWAPI.COMALLRIGHTSRESERVED.昆明秀派科技有限公司

本网站所列接口及文档全部由SHOWAPI网站提供,并对其拥有最终解释权POWEREDBYSHOWAPI

THE END
1.一个基于jQuery的简单树形菜单小浩叔叔想修改又无从下手,所以有单独写一个简单的树形菜单的想法,趁下班的时间,抽空写了一个简单的JS文件,基于jQuery1.6版本的 SimpleTree。 SimpleTree使用起来比较方便,它实现了最基本的树形菜单的功能,包括1个JS文件、1个CSS文件和5个图标文件。 使用时只要将相关文件复制到项目中,并在相应的页面引用它就行,例如: https://www.cnblogs.com/zhhh/archive/2011/11/25/2263781.html
2.jQuery树菜单插件jQuery可选择多级树菜单插件,jQuery支持ajax树菜单插件,jQuery文本框多级下拉树菜单,jQuery二级树菜单插件手风琴,jQuery可拖拽树结构菜单,经典jQuery树菜单插件,jQuery树菜单插件,Bootstrap风格treeview多级树菜单插件,Bootstrap实现多级树菜单JQuery插件。下载jQuery树菜单https://www.bootstrapmb.com/tag/shucaidan
3.jQuery树形菜单插件zTree插件描述:zTree 是一个依靠 jQuery 实现的多功能 “树插件”。优异的性能、灵活的配置、多种功能的组合是 zTree 最大优点。 更新时间:2017/5/24下午5:37:58 更新说明:更新至zTree v3.5.28版 zTree v3.x 入门指南 考虑到还是会有第一次使用 zTree 的朋友,因此入门指南不能少,至少让大家快速明白如何开始https://www.jq22.com/jquery-info941
4.jQuery树型菜单插件(Treeview)菜鸟教程jQuery Treeview 提供了一个无序灵活的可折叠的树形菜单。适用于一些菜单的导航,支持基于 cookie 的持久性菜单。 <ulid="browser"class="filetree treeview-famfamfam">Folder 1Item 1.1Item 1.1.1Folder 2Subfolder 2.1<ulid="folder21">File 2.1.1File 2.1.2Subfolder 2.2</https://www.runoob.com/jquery/jquery-plugin-treeview.html
5.jQuery实现树形菜单的三种方法jquery树形菜单<!DOCTYPEhtml> 树形菜单 $(function(){ $(".treeMenu>li>a").click(function(){ // 方法一,需要给点击的a元素加id属性 // 获取当前点击的a元素的id值 // var idName = $(this).attr("id"); // 对象紧跟着当前点击的a元素的ul进行类样式反转 // $("https://blog.csdn.net/qq_36639124/article/details/81220665
6.jquery树形菜单增删改jquery下拉树形菜单jquery 树形菜单增删改 jquery下拉树形菜单 jQuery ztree实现动态树形多选菜单 编程之家收集整理的这篇文章主要介绍了jQuery ztree实现动态树形多选菜单,觉得挺不错的,现在分享给大家,也给大家做个参考。 我用到的版本ztree core v3.5.24,需要引入的js,css,jquery.js,jquery.ztree.core.js,jquery.ztree.excheck.https://blog.51cto.com/u_16213613/10917271
7.jQueryEasyUI树形菜单–树形菜单加载父/子节点jQuery EasyUI 树形菜单 -树形菜单加载父/子节点 通常表示一个树节点的方式就是在每一个节点存储一个 parentid。 这个也被称为邻接列表模型。 直接加载这些数据到树形菜单(Tree)是不允许的。 但是我们可以在加载树形菜单之前,把它转换为标准标准的树形菜单(Tree)数据格式。 树(Tree)插件提供一个 'loadFilter' 选项http://edu.jb51.net/jeasyui/jeasyui-tree-tree6.html
8.jquery+CSS实现的多级竖向展开树形TRee菜单效果本文实例讲述了jquery+CSS实现的多级竖向展开树形TRee菜单效果。分享给大家供大家参考。具体如下:这里演示垂直的树形菜单,应用CSS和jquery技术来实现,显示在网页左侧比较合适,考虑到简洁,没有使用图片之类的作修饰。本效果兼容IE、火狐等主流浏览器。运行效果截图如下: 在线演示地址如下: http://demo.jb51.net/js/2015https://www.iteye.com/resource/weixin_38547532-13142574
9.基于jquery实现的树形菜单效果代码jqueryjs教程本文实例讲述了基于jquery实现的树形菜单效果代码。分享给大家供大家参考。具体如下: 这是一款基于jquery实现的树形菜单代码,点击菜单项可以向下滑出对应的二级菜单,效果流畅自然。 先来看看运行效果截图: 在线演示地址如下: http://demo.jb51.net/js/2015/jquery-tree-style-show-menu-codes/ 具体代码如下: jquery的https://m.php.cn/faq/5066.html
10.jsTreeSelectjquery树形下拉菜单开发实例源码下载jsTreeSelect jquery 树形下拉菜单 一般编程问题 下载此实例 开发语言:Others 实例大小:4.73M 下载次数:5 浏览次数:257 发布时间:2021-11-14 实例类别:一般编程问题 发布人:js2021 文件格式:.rar 所需积分:2 网友评论举报投诉收藏该页 同类人气实例 【Others】 Scratch动画演示(入门级)https://www.haolizi.net/example/view_232265.html
11.jquerytree树形结构导航菜单代码jquery tree树形结构导航菜单代码 jquery tree树形结构在网页设计中必不可少,尤其是在后台管理模板(不兼容IE6,7,8浏览器)https://www.17sucai.com/pins/16490.html
12.jquery人员组织树人员组织结构图怎么制作zTree是最流行的一款jquery树形控件。 zTree的jquery树插件就可以生成树了。 jquery怎么获取动态生成的树形菜单的属性 只需先执行方法一后再执行方法二即可获得动态生成的元素的属性(必须在方法一执行后再执行方法二才能获取到)。 jquery中用attr()方法来获取和设置元素属性,attr是attribute(属性)的缩写,在jQuery DOMhttp://chengdu.cdxwcx.cn/article/diiseee.html
13.jQuery+Bootstrap手写树形菜单手写树形结构菜单并实现点击的交互效果 <!DOCTYPE html><!--Bootstrap.css -->*{ margin: 0; padding: 0; } html{ padding: 20px; } .row{ margin: 20px 0; } .row label{ line-height: 30px; margin: 0; text-align: right; font-weight: normal; } .text-left { text-align: left; } .https://www.jianshu.com/p/83c0db044371
14.jquerytreetable树形表格菜单插件素材8网菜单,树形,网页特效,treetable,表格,插件 网页特效 文件目录树导航菜单网页特效下载。 素材8网-专注前端素材!https://www.sucai8.cn/43872.html
15.Layui掌握的LayUI树形权限菜单,助力你的权限管理!简介:LayUI是一款基于jQuery的前端UI框架,而树形权限菜单是一种常见的网页导航菜单设计。LayUI树形权限菜单结合了LayUI框架的特性和树状结构的展示方式,用于实现对用户权限的管理和控制。树形权限菜单通常由多层级的树状菜单构成,每个节点表示一个功能或者页面,父节点表示上级菜单,子节点表示下级菜单。通过这种层级结构,可https://developer.aliyun.com/article/1338789
16.zTree:JQuery树形插件使用示例腾讯云开发者社区zTree:JQuery树形插件使用示例 最近在做一个Web平台,其中想用一个树形展示。上网搜了搜基于JQuery的树形插件还真不少,最后选定zTree。关于zTree这里只是简单给出一个使用的示例。 首先声明zTree的配置信息,然后声明zTree的节点信息,最后初始化zTree。 下面给出一个示例:https://cloud.tencent.com/developer/article/1387777